Optimal order of uniform convergence for finite element method on Bakhvalov-type meshes
We propose a new analysis of convergence for a th order () finite
element method, which is applied on Bakhvalov-type meshes to a singularly
perturbed two-point boundary value problem. A novel interpolant is introduced,
which has a simple structure and is easy to generalize. By means of this
interpolant, we prove an optimal order of uniform convergence with respect to
the perturbation parameter.
Numerical experiments illustrate these theoretical results.Comment: 12page
